I have an original LRP Sphere and have been running it in my losi with a 10.5 tekin and either a savox 1258tg or a futaba S9551 servo with a 4pk fasst with the R604 fs receiver. Sometimes it just felt a little disjointed but generally ok.
I felt like a change so decided to get an old on road car going so put the radio, speedo and servo in my old pro4 but used a murfdogg 17.5 Horrendous, the steering just seems to wander when on full power, left or right, usually the way you last steered. I went thru the car, then tried the other servo, then another one, and the servo settings on the tx. I tried another receiver, a R614ff, same problem.
I looked for a car issue, ballends, servo saver etc, nothing. I then tried it all in another car, my Schumacher Mi4. No difference, I then tried another radio all together, a basic spektrum. Its actually worse, without putting the car on the ground, the steering shakes madly.........
WTF is it?! Can anyone throw light on this? I assume its the speedo but would like to know why. The speedo hasn't much use on it!
